Traviss Technical College Precision Metal Working Undergraduate Certificate Degrees

In the most recent year for which we have data, Traviss Technical College awarded 21 undergraduate certificate degrees in precision metal working.

Undergraduate Certificate Student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 95% of precision metal working undergraduate certificate degrees went to men and 5% went to women.

Traviss Technical College gender breakdown of Precision Metal Working Undergraduate Certificate degree grads The largest share of precision metal working undergraduate certificate degree graduates at Traviss Technical College were Hispanic or Latino. Approximately 52%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Traviss Technical College with a undergraduate certificate in precision metal working.

Ethnic diversity of Precision Metal Working majors at Traviss Technical College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 11
White 9
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 1
